Bleach: Thousand-Year Blood War Part 4 Unveils Production Designs for Kisuke’s Bankai and Yoruichi’s Thunder Beast Transformation

On March 31, 2025, TV Tokyo hosted a highly anticipated live stream unveiling details about Bleach: Thousand-Year Blood War Part 4. During this event, key production staff showcased storyboards and character designs for Kisuke Urahara’s Bankai and Yoruichi Shihoin’s Thunder Beast or Cat form. However, a release date for this final segment of the arc was not disclosed.

As the concluding chapter of the Thousand-Year Blood War arc, this installment builds on the story crafted by Tite Kubo in his renowned manga series, *Bleach*. It will follow directly from the previous installment, which aired 14 episodes between October and December 2024.

TV Tokyo’s Special Episode Highlights Character Designs for Part 4

During the special episode, titled Bleach: Thousand-Year Blood War Part 4 – The Calamity, the production team unveiled impressive storyboard designs. Fans were treated to visuals of Kisuke Urahara’s Bankai, Kannonbiraki: Benihime Aratame, and Yoruichi Shihoin’s formidable Thunder Beast form, Shunko: Raijin Senkei: Shunryu Kokobyo Senki. The sketches showcased intricate details, including close-ups and dynamic movements of both characters, enhancing excitement among viewers.

The artwork gave fans a glimpse of Kisuke’s transformed hand and enhanced eyes, alongside detailed line art representing his Bankai. In Yoruichi’s illustrations, she is depicted engulfed in electricity, displaying feline attributes during her Thunder Beast transformation.

General Director and Composer Tomohisa Taguchi confirmed that the production of Bleach: Thousand-Year Blood War Part 4 – The Calamity is well underway, promising an abundance of original content. While he refrained from stating a specific release date, it appears that fans may have to wait for a while before the new episodes are fully prepared.

This upcoming installment will begin its adaptation from chapter 661 of the original manga. With only 25 chapters remaining to be adapted, it is expected that this part will include many original sequences to enrich the narrative.

Additional Context and Streaming Information

The previous addition to the series premiered on October 5, 2024, on TV Tokyo and its related networks in Japan. Internationally, platforms like Netflix, Hulu, and Disney+ have made the series accessible to worldwide fans.

Directed by Hikaru Murata, the third cour was managed by Pierrot Films, a subsidiary of Studio Pierrot, with Tomohisa Taguchi at the helm as general manager. Character designs were executed by Masashi Kudo, while the soundtrack was composed by Shiro Sagisu.
